A 59-year-old male asked:
I recently had a biopsy of my prostate because my psa level was 15. no cancer was found. now my urologist wants me to get an mri. is this necessary?

I think yes.: Biopsy is just a sampling. It could be falsely negative. If your urology specialist thinks that your risk of cancer is high enough to justify further testing, you should follow his advice. Prostate cancer is a serious condition.
